Output 74c315a39be632e043a5d50ed5dc26d54cf8b654351013bf36b24bed0adc85c0:5

value
14729673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f40b3e031e0fe4f0c7e3c369198f5251791fbc9 OP_EQUALVERIFY OP_CHECKSIG
address
19gehqqrbcK2sfV9cG7HQ59CyJig3rSLEZ
transaction
74c315a39be632e043a5d50ed5dc26d54cf8b654351013bf36b24bed0adc85c0
spent
true